[SCSI] zfcp: optimize zfcp_qdio_account
authorHeiko Carstens <heiko.carstens@de.ibm.com>
Tue, 18 Aug 2009 13:43:32 +0000 (15:43 +0200)
committerJames Bottomley <James.Bottomley@suse.de>
Sat, 5 Sep 2009 13:49:49 +0000 (08:49 -0500)
commit41e05a12c7aae16f0381103af3e5ca791e87ce59
tree3db57f11d9f2183215a52796fea113ce96b5abd8
parentb592e89ac9af521be164490e45c53c93e89c776f
[SCSI] zfcp: optimize zfcp_qdio_account

Remove expensive ktime_get()/ktime_us_delta() functions from the hot
path and use get_clock_monotonic() instead. This elimates seven
function calls and avoids a lot of unnecessary calculations.

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
Signed-off-by: Christof Schmitt <christof.schmitt@de.ibm.com>
Signed-off-by: James Bottomley <James.Bottomley@suse.de>
drivers/s390/scsi/zfcp_def.h
drivers/s390/scsi/zfcp_qdio.c